Arabian ouds are Ordinarily much larger than their Turkish and Persian counterparts, manufacturing a fuller, further sound, whereas the seem on the Turkish oud is much more taut and shrill, not least as the Turkish oud will likely be (and partly) tuned just one complete stage higher compared to Arabian.[54] Turkish ouds are typically far more lightly manufactured than Arabian by having an unfinished audio board, lower string motion and with string courses put closer with each other.

This distinction is just not based entirely on geography; the Arabic oud is uncovered not simply while in the Arabian Peninsula but throughout the Arab planet.[fifty] Turkish ouds have already been played by Anatolian Greeks, where by They're identified as outi, and in other areas during the Mediterranean.
In the event the Umayyads conquered Hispania in 711, they brought their ud along. An oud is depicted as remaining played by a seated musician[33] in Qasr Amra of your Umayyad dynasty, one of several earliest depictions of the instrument as performed in early Islamic history.
For some of its background and in the majority of places, the oud has become fretless and, even in Iran, the abandonment of frets began to take place inside the sixteenth century.
